LAKE PLACID v. ELIZABETHTOWN


131 A.D.2d 159 (1987)

Lake Placid Club Attached Lodges, Appellant, v. Elizabethtown Builders, Inc., et al., Respondents

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Third Department.

November 5, 1987


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Hancock & Estabrook (Robert A. Small of counsel), for appellant.

Miller, Mannix, Lemery & Pratt (Benjamin R. Pratt, Jr., of counsel), for Elizabethtown Builders, Inc., respondent.

Sugarman, Wallace, Manheim & Schoenwald (Timothy J. Perry of counsel), for Wallace, McHarg, Roberts & Todd, respondent.

KANE, J. P., MAIN, MIKOLL and HARVEY, JJ., concur.


LEVINE, J.

Plaintiff is an unincorporated joint venture, the members of which are owners of residential condominium units in a four-building project in the Village of Lake Placid, Essex County, developed by Lake Placid Company (hereinafter the developer).
